What should be avoided until a vehicle's system is fully deactivated?

Explanation:
The correct answer is to avoid cutting the steering column until a vehicle's system is fully deactivated. This is crucial because the steering column may be integrated with electronic systems that can become hazardous if tampered with while the vehicle is still active. For example, cutting the steering column may inadvertently trigger airbag deployment or affect the function of other electronic components that are still receiving power. In general, ensuring that a vehicle's systems are completely deactivated helps in reducing the risk of injury to first responders, occupants, or bystanders during the extrication process. Properly following protocols for deactivating all vehicle systems, such as disabling the battery and ensuring the vehicle is in a safe state, is essential to prevent unexpected hazards.
